Output 59276dd810a3a28eedaaee8ddf84c0baab12c64b8e28bc47989bb1ab5e146eb4:0

value
1987148
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db8672f7077ba71fbef46c80e28d4736d465a180 OP_EQUAL
address
3MhkyEucYh58XVPcWa6nr8VLp1WVsz18cR
transaction
59276dd810a3a28eedaaee8ddf84c0baab12c64b8e28bc47989bb1ab5e146eb4
spent
true